STA2 Off

FPGA Node Power Not Present

Kuka · Sunrise Cabinet Med Controller

What does STA2 Off mean?

The STA2 Orange LED for the FPGA node is OFF, indicating no supply voltage is present for the FPGA node. This prevents the FPGA node from operating, which is crucial for high-speed logic and data processing within the controller.

Common Causes

  • The FPGA Node (STA2) is not receiving power.
  • Main power supply failure affecting the FPGA node.
  • Disconnection or damage to the power cable for STA2.
  • Issue with the power regulation circuit for STA2.

Repair Steps & Checklist

Click steps to track your progress.

  1. 1

    Check the infeed power supply at connector X1.

  2. 2

    If the PWR/3.3V LED (Item 6, Page 98) lights up, indicating the 3.3V power is present, exchange the CCU_SR module, as the fault is likely internal to the module's power distribution for the FPGA node.
